The Seven Arts Of Change book by David Shaner is all about leading business transformation that lasts. It’s well worth your read. Some of my favorite leadership lesson takeaways include: Personal Progress : Most leaders miss the fact that every employee possesses a latent willingness to change. Leaders often ignore the fact that personal progress is one of our strongest human desires. Your job as the leader is to connect the new business need with an opportunity for personal progress. Compassion : We all willingly follow and model a leader who makes an effort to truly understand us. That is because such leaders exude compassion. Change : There is no other more compassionate activity than listening and then responding in a way that demonstrates genuine understanding.
